Formula 1 star Kimi Antonelli swapped the racetrack for the DJ booth when he was spotted behind South African superstar DJ Black Coffee during his set in Sardinia. The young Italian driver was not exactly tearing up the dance floor, but he looked perfectly content soaking up the atmosphere and interacting with those around him. Naturally, fans watching the clip had plenty to say about the rather wholesome sight of Antonelli enjoying a night out.

Kimi keeps it cool behind Black Coffee

In the video shared by @Phi Beach, Black Coffee can be seen working the decks while Antonelli stands just behind him. Rather than putting on a wild dance display, the F1 driver appears to be taking everything in, occasionally moving along to the music and interacting with people nearby.

Black Coffee honoured in Mexico

Recently Briefly News reported that South Africans were left impressed after a spectacular drone show paid tribute to DJ Black Coffee during his performance in Mexico. Hundreds of drones lit up the night sky, forming a huge glowing image of the Grammy-winning DJ as he watched alongside the crowd.

The breathtaking display earned loud applause and had Mzansi supporters celebrating Coffee’s international recognition, with many praising the star for receiving such a memorable tribute far from home.
